Vitamin D's impact on fibromyalgiaRole of Vitamin D Status and Alterations in Gut Microbiota Metabolism in Fibromyalgia-Associated Chronic Inflammatory Pain.
Most Relevant Research
We set out to explore how vitamin D levels relate to chronic pain in fibromyalgia, particularly focusing on the role of gut microbiota. Our investigation involved 68 female patients with fibromyalgia, measuring pain intensity and various biomarkers in their blood, including inflammatory cytokines and vitamin D levels.
Our findings revealed that the patients had a moderate level of fibromyalgia-related pain, as shown by their average FIQ-R scores. Interestingly, we found that lower levels of vitamin D were associated with higher pain scores, and several inflammatory markers were elevated in the patients. Additionally, we noted a concerning trend where patients with lower acetate levels—a product of gut microbiota metabolism—also demonstrated an increased kynurenine/tryptophan ratio, linked to inflammation. This suggests a complex interaction between vitamin D status and gut health in fibromyalgia.
While it appears that vitamin D and altered gut metabolism may significantly impact inflammatory pain in fibromyalgia, our study highlights the need for further research with larger patient populations to clarify these relationships. Overall, our findings suggest that enhancing vitamin D levels could play a beneficial role in managing fibromyalgia symptoms, though conclusive evidence is still required.
